POI : Tussock
Type : Cultro
Name : Tussock Cultro - Yellow

First discovered for ExTool : Karl berg
Robust photosynthetic plants similar in appearance to clump grasses. They have a shallow but complex root structure, which requires a solid surface to produce structural stability. Clumps may form through tillering or wider dispersal through a variety of seeding mechanisms. Some species have adapted cellular structures containing high sugar concentrations to protect against freezing damage.

A tussock species with tall sharp reeds reaching about two metres, characterised by narrow markings along their length.
